Job description

Total Talent Solutions is now hiring for a Machine Operator

Location: McPherson, KS $19.50 per hour Schedule: Monday-Thursday | 6:00 AM - 4:30 PM

Education Requirements
  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Technical training or manufacturing education is beneficial.
Experience Requirements
  • 3-5 years of experience in a custom build shop preferred
  • Experience operating manufacturing equipment preferredAbility to read and interpret blueprints and schematics
Job Duties
  • Set up and operate manufacturing machinery to produce quality parts
  • Work with saws, press brakes, laser equipment, and plasma machines
  • Locate and identify materials needed for production jobs
  • Complete material requisitions accurately
  • Produce finished components according to quality standards
  • Enter time and labor reporting information daily
  • Move materials, tools, and equipment manually or with a jib crane
  • Layout, cut, and fit parts as required
  • Fabricate metal components according to specifications and safety requirements
  • Troubleshoot production issues and develop effective solutions
  • Maintain tools, equipment, and workstations in a clean and safe condition
  • Coordinate workflow with team members and other departments
  • Complete production and quality assurance documentation
  • Communicate with engineering and production teams as needed
  • Participate in continuous improvement and 5S activities
  • Follow all company safety, quality, and housekeeping standards
  • Perform additional duties as assigned
Preferred Qualifications
  • Previous machine operation, manufacturing, production, or industrial experience is preferred.
  • Experience performing machine setup, tooling changes, troubleshooting, or preventative maintenance is beneficial.
  • Knowledge of Lean manufacturing, quality systems, or continuous improvement practices is considered an asset.
  • Individuals who demonstrate mechanical ability, reliability, teamwork, and a commitment to quality are well positioned for success as a Machine Operator.
Physical Capabilities
  • Ability to stand, walk, bend, and perform repetitive production tasks throughout 10 hour shift.
  • Ability to lift materials, components, or finished products weighing up to 25 pounds.
  • Frequent use of hands for repetitive tasks
  • Ability to safely operate manufacturing equipment while maintaining awareness of moving machinery.
  • Ability to wear required personal protective equipment and work safely in a manufacturing environment.
